Understanding Bodyweight Exercises

Bodyweight exercises use your own weight to perform movements, which can be done anywhere without equipment. They’re ideal for those with limited space and time.

Benefits of Bodyweight Exercises

  1. Convenience: No equipment required, making it easy to fit into any schedule.
  2. Versatility: Can be modified for all fitness levels.
  3. Functional Strength: Improves overall body control and coordination.

Common Bodyweight Exercises

  • Push-Ups: 3 sets of 10-15 reps, 30 seconds rest. Focus on keeping your body straight.
  • Squats: 3 sets of 15 reps, 30 seconds rest. Push through your heels.
  • Plank: 3 sets of 30 seconds, 30 seconds rest. Keep your body in a straight line.

Exploring Dumbbell Workouts

Dumbbell workouts provide a way to add resistance training into your routine, which can help build strength and muscle mass.

Benefits of Dumbbell Workouts

  1. Versatile Resistance: Easily adjust weight to match your fitness level.
  2. Targeted Muscle Groups: Allows for isolation of specific muscles.
  3. Increased Intensity: Can elevate heart rate and increase calorie burn.

Common Dumbbell Exercises

  • Dumbbell Bench Press: 3 sets of 10 reps, 45 seconds rest. Squeeze at the top.
  • Bent-Over Rows: 3 sets of 12 reps, 45 seconds rest. Keep back flat.
  • Dumbbell Lunges: 3 sets of 10 reps per leg, 45 seconds rest. Step forward with control.

Comparing Effectiveness

Space and Equipment

  • Bodyweight: Requires no equipment; perfect for small spaces.
  • Dumbbell: Requires weights, needing more space for storage and movement.

Time Efficiency

Both workouts can be tailored to fit into a 30-minute time frame, but bodyweight exercises can often be quicker to set up and perform.

Strength and Muscle Gains

Dumbbell workouts generally provide more potential for muscle growth due to the added resistance, while bodyweight exercises excel in developing functional strength and endurance.

Conclusion

Ultimately, the choice between bodyweight exercises and dumbbell workouts depends on your personal goals, available space, and time constraints. If you’re looking for convenience and functional strength, bodyweight exercises are a great fit. If you aim for muscle growth and increased strength, incorporate dumbbells into your routine.
